Optical illusions are fascinating visual puzzles that trick our brains into seeing something different from reality. These illusions work by taking advantage of how our brains process visual information, leading us to perceive things in unusual ways.
They can involve distorted images, hidden objects, or ambiguous shapes that challenge our perception and force us to think critically.
Optical illusions come in various forms, such as geometric patterns, color contrasts, and even motion illusions, where static images seem to move. Some illusions play with perspective, while others rely on color, light, or shadows to deceive the eye.
Not only are optical illusions fun to solve, but they also offer a great way to exercise the brain. They improve focus, attention to detail, and problem-solving skills.
